Complementing Cassandra and Open Search

0

I will like to complement and connect Cassandra with the Open Search Service to permit my users to query their data and have access to their searches.

There is no direct way to connect AWS OpenSearch Service with Cassandra. However, to enable users to query their data in OpenSearch, data integration or ETL process can be used such as tools like Apache NiFi, Logstash (with an appropriate input plugin for Cassandra), or AWS Glue.

The process generally involves extracting data from Cassandra, transforming it, and then indexing it into OpenSearch cluster. Once in OpenSearch, user can perform search queries directly. Please refer to following link:
